|
|
@@ -312,20 +312,28 @@
|
|
|
function getMonth() {
|
|
|
let sdateTo = new Date()
|
|
|
// console.log(sdateTo.getMonth() - 1)
|
|
|
- return sdateTo.getMonth() - 1
|
|
|
+ if (sdateTo.getMonth() === 0) {
|
|
|
+ return 11
|
|
|
+ } else {
|
|
|
+ return sdateTo.getMonth() - 1
|
|
|
+ }
|
|
|
}
|
|
|
function getYear() {
|
|
|
let num = 2000
|
|
|
let sdateTo = new Date()
|
|
|
let _year = sdateTo.getFullYear()
|
|
|
for (let i = 0; i < 99; i++) {
|
|
|
- num++
|
|
|
- if (num === Number(_year)) {
|
|
|
- num = i
|
|
|
- break
|
|
|
- }
|
|
|
+ num++
|
|
|
+ if (num === Number(_year)) {
|
|
|
+ num = i
|
|
|
+ break
|
|
|
+ }
|
|
|
+ }
|
|
|
+ if (sdateTo.getMonth() === 0) {
|
|
|
+ return num - 1
|
|
|
+ } else {
|
|
|
+ return num
|
|
|
}
|
|
|
- return num
|
|
|
}
|
|
|
export default {
|
|
|
layout: 'mobileNoHeader',
|
|
|
@@ -424,8 +432,18 @@
|
|
|
})
|
|
|
this.getUnread()
|
|
|
let sdateTo = new Date()
|
|
|
- this.isShowApcheckList.thisMonth = sdateTo.getFullYear() + '-' + sdateTo.getMonth()
|
|
|
- this.outTimeMonth = sdateTo.getFullYear() + '-' + sdateTo.getMonth()
|
|
|
+ if (sdateTo.getMonth() === 0) {
|
|
|
+ let _time = new Date(sdateTo)
|
|
|
+ _time.setMonth(_time.getMonth())
|
|
|
+ _time.setDate(1)
|
|
|
+ // _time.setMonth(_time.getMonth())
|
|
|
+ _time.setDate(_time.getDate() - 1)
|
|
|
+ this.isShowApcheckList.thisMonth = _time.getFullYear() + '-' + (_time.getMonth() + 1)
|
|
|
+ this.outTimeMonth = _time.getFullYear() + '-' + (_time.getMonth() + 1)
|
|
|
+ } else {
|
|
|
+ this.isShowApcheckList.thisMonth = sdateTo.getFullYear() + '-' + sdateTo.getMonth()
|
|
|
+ this.outTimeMonth = sdateTo.getFullYear() + '-' + sdateTo.getMonth()
|
|
|
+ }
|
|
|
},
|
|
|
// mounted() {
|
|
|
// this.$nextTick(() => {
|